Unique group of items: an ANS signed "J. Carter," one page, 6.25 x 8.5, personal letterhead, in full: "Despite the erroneous headline, we won the '76 Wisconsin primary, reminding us of the 'Dewey Defeats Truman' 1948 newspaper headline"; and an 8 x 10 print of Carter holding up a Milwaukee Sentinel newspaper with the headline, 'Carter Upset by Udall,' signed in silver ink, "Jimmy Carter," and also signed in the lower border by the photographer. Additionally includes a matte-finish 10 x 8 photo of the iconic 'Dewey Defeats Truman' image. In overall fine condition. A one-of-a-kind lot connecting Carter to his idol, Harry S. Truman.
